Originally Posted by Drakosd
I noticed Nimbley has a 3rd brake pulsar. What do you think of this? Ive been thinking of getting one. Was it an easy install?
Yes, easy to install. Check around for best price. I think I paid toooo much for the one I got. Also, before splicing in the wires (cutting them) make sure the pulsar isn't in the way of the inside panel plug hole. I cut mine a hair short and the pulsar is sorta over my plastic trim hole. Doesn't fit as flush as before. It's ok but wish I had thought it out a little better before cutting.
You know, "measure twice and cut once". LOL

A little color, and some additional power outlets. I installed the outlets inside the panel under the steering column so I could run the power supply to my Sirius without having a bunch of wires sticking out. I ran the power supply and the antenna wire under the dash and through the slats under the radio/climate control. Came out pretty good.

Sirius install. I got the aux in and installed it on the inside of the right pillar then used a retractible cord. The cord sucks up nicely so it's not all over, but I can unplug it from the Sirius, pull it out, and use it on my iPod or phone for Pandora.
